John Ghazvinian, author of “The Curse of Oil” in the new issue of VQR, will be interviewed today at 5:00 p.m. by Coy Barefoot on Charlottesville radio station WINA. A podcast of the interview should be available early next week and we’ll supply a link when it’s posted. We posted Ghazvinian’s essay on 12/26 after news of another pipeline explosion in Nigeria, and thanks to linking sites like Arts & Letters Daily and Bookslut, it’s become one of the most-read essays on our site in the past three years. WINA will also be interviewing David Morris, author of “The Big Suck: Notes from the Jarhead Underground” and VQR editor Ted Genoways in the coming weeks.

UPDATE: the podcast of Ghazvinian’s interview is now available at the Charlottesville Podcasting Network.
